China’s electric car sales slump, squeezing automakers

China accounts for half of electric vehicle sales worldwide, making any change in its market critical for the global industry. In China, about 70% of the 1.2 million electric or gasoline-electric hybrid models sold over the past year went to government and company fleets, according to Bernstein. “I also worry that when an electric car has a problem, it will cost me a fortune to repair,” said Yang. Battery supplier CATL Ltd. is competing with Japan’s Panasonic and South Korea’s LG Chem to be the industry’s biggest global producer.
